The Brotherhood Crusade Life Skills & Entrepreneur Trainer will educate, inform and guide Youth and Young Adults enrolled in our YouthSource Center. The incumbent will be charged to train and provide in- and out-of- classroom settings that cause young people to value, aspire to and fully adopt attitudes, behaviors and beliefs that facilitate their current and future success in school and in life. This includes providing a curriculum that fosters creativity, critical thinking, problem solving, decision making and the ability to effectively communicate along with personal and social responsibility that will contribute to good citizenship.
Specifically, the Life Skills & Entrepreneur Trainer shall cause 14-29 year old South Los Angeles County young people (with an emphasis on individuals who present with barriers to employment) to successfully graduate from Brotherhood Crusade’s workforce development program, which includes Brotherhood Crusade’s Stepwise Employment Experiences pathway, and be well-prepared to secure, thrive in, advance in and sustain employment in a living wage or more highly-compensated career or entrepreneurship. Importantly, the goal of the Brotherhood Crusade YouthSource Center is to provide services to young people that improve their life by causing them to self-actualize, increase their agency and self-determination, develop vocational power (life and social) and technical skills, improve their academic proficiency, and facilitate their adoption of success principles that lead to self-reliance as well as subsequent advancement with respect to their career goals and objectives. To this end, the Life Skills & Entrepreneur Trainer shall build meaningful relationships with program participants; instruct beginning, intermediate and advanced job preparation, entrepreneurship training and continuation classes; instruct financial education classes; establish partnerships with employers and workforce training institutions with respect to the use and instruction of their curricula; work with the YouthSource Center team effectuate desired outcomes for participants; and develop curricula for and instruct program participants who have been placed in stepwise employment opportunities to ensure sustained learning and growth in accordance with their individual-specific youth development plans.
